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ations

When selecting a black hot water dispenser, consider the following factors to balance function, safety, and value:

  • Capacity and usage: Choose between 2/3-gallon tanks for compact spaces and 5-gallon bottom-loading models for high-volume needs without frequent refills.
  • Temperature control: Look for near-boiling hot water around 200°F and the ability to set multiple temperatures for beverages and soups.
  • Safety features: Child-safety locks, BPA-free components, and insulated tanks reduce the risk of accidental burns and improve hygiene.
  • Installation and space: Under-sink or countertop configurations vary in space requirements. Matte black finishes pair well with contemporary kitchens.
  • Maintenance: Self-cleaning UV options and easy-to-clean drip trays help prevent mineral buildup and odors; consider bottom-loading designs to minimize lifting strain.
  • Water filtration: Some models offer filter compatibility for improved taste and odor; confirm compatibility with your preferred filter type.
  • Durability and warranty: Stainless steel tanks and reputable brands tend to offer longer lifespans and better support for home and office use.
  • Energy efficiency: On-demand heating minimizes standby energy use, an important consideration for homes with frequent hot-water demands.
